The Audi R8 V10 may be the most complete supercar ever built.

Combining Lamborghini-derived V10 performance, everyday drivability, exceptional build quality, and timeless styling, the R8 redefined what enthusiasts expected from an exotic car. While many supercars sacrifice comfort and reliability in pursuit of performance, the R8 delivered all three.

Powered by a naturally aspirated 5.2L V10 and available with Audi’s legendary Quattro all-wheel-drive system, the R8 became one of the few supercars owners could comfortably drive every day while still enjoying exotic performance whenever the road opened up.

Today, the first-generation R8 V10 is widely regarded as one of the smartest exotic car purchases available.

Garage Guide Tip

Service history matters significantly more than mileage.

A properly maintained R8 with higher mileage is often a better purchase than a neglected low-mileage example.


Best Model Years

πŸ₯‡ 2014–2015 Audi R8 V10 Plus

β€’ Peak production years

β€’ 550 horsepower

β€’ Refined dual-clutch transmission

β€’ Strongest collector demand

β€’ Best ownership experience


πŸ₯ˆ 2012–2013 Audi R8 V10

β€’ Updated technology

β€’ Improved refinement

β€’ Excellent value proposition


πŸ₯‰ 2009–2011 Audi R8 V10

β€’ Available gated manual transmission

β€’ Pure analog driving experience

β€’ Increasing collector appeal


Garage Guide Note

Manual-transmission V10 cars continue to appreciate and are among the most desirable R8 models.


Proceed Carefully

Magnetic Ride Suspension

Replacement components can be expensive.

Verify proper operation before purchase.


Carbon Buildup

Direct injection engines may require periodic intake cleaning.


Clutch Wear

Manual and R-Tronic equipped vehicles should be inspected carefully.


Neglected Maintenance

Deferred maintenance can quickly become expensive.


Garage Guide Warning

The cheapest R8 is rarely the least expensive one to own.
